Although MAFS season 18 has been top of mind for most viewers, the scandal that took place on Married At First Sight season 17 is still something many are cognizant of. MAFS season 17, which featured five couples getting to know one another and trying to build relationships in Denver, Colorado, was meant to be an exciting one for the series, but turned into one of the worst seasons of the show overall. Throughout the season, it was clear that things were off with most of the couples and many complained that their arguments felt off or disingenuous in nature.

While there were moments within Married At First Sight season 17 where the couples were sharing their genuine feelings and emotions, it was clear that there was something else going on throughout the experiment that led to so many people feeling like the show wasn’t tackling actual issues between the pairs. When it came out during the MAFS season 17 reunion that the cast had orchestrated drama for themselves throughout the season, creating superficial storylines to show on camera while their actual relationships were happening in the moments they spent alone, it was clear how off-course the series had become.

Although the issues with MAFS season 17’s cast caused chaos during the aftermath of the season and throughout the reunion episodes, their issues were contained in a lot of ways. Though they’d lied about their relationships and issues, they’d done so in a way that allowed there to still be some major drama on the show, and they’d come clean about it with the ability for the MAFS experts to question them. The issues with Married At First Sight season 17 were major, but the drama that viewers haven’t seen on MAFS season 18, in my opinion, is far worse.

The Married At First Sight season 18 cast has openly been trying to hide the fact that two of the cast members in different marriages are having an affair rather than letting things play out openly. While it’s possible Michelle may know about David & Madison’s affair while Allen doesn’t, I’m starting to believe that David & Madison got caught early in the season and came clean to their partners by the time the MAFS honeymoons ended. With the couples hiding in plain sight, I think the Married At First Sight season 18 scandal has been far more disrespectful than its predecessor.
